Top definition
A mythical mountaneer in Faroe Island folklore. Basically he was a succesful man with regards to the mountaneering society but harboured a dark sexual desire for young children.
Mate, you look like Scrimelious Hovaldemotropus just paid you a little visit.
by Eagle eyed billy bob January 25, 2010
Get the mug
Get a Scrimelious Hovaldemotropus mug for your dad Jerry.